When the idol is immersed

The idol is kept for one and a half, three, five, seven days or until Anant Chaturdashi — it is a family custom rather than a rule, and community mandapams usually keep it longest.

Use the designated immersion point

Many gram panchayats and municipalities set aside a pond or a marked stretch of tank for immersion. Ask at the panchayat office — it changes year to year, and a drinking-water tank or a farm pond is not an alternative.

Unpainted clay dissolves, plaster of Paris does not

A clay idol breaks down in water within hours. Plaster of Paris does not, and the paints carry heavy metals, so idols accumulate in tanks and rivers after immersion. Pollution control boards in most states now ask for clay for exactly this reason.

Someone should be watching the water, not the idol

Immersion points get crowded and the bank is slippery after the monsoon. Children go into the water at these gatherings every year. Keep one person watching the water rather than the procession.

Take the accessories home

Thermocol, plastic sheeting, cloth and metal ornaments do not belong in the tank even when the idol itself is clay. Most organised immersion points now have a collection bin at the bank for them.

Murarpur at a glance

Murarpur is a village of 1,353 people in 268 households (Census 2011) in Bindki tehsil, Fatehpur district, Uttar Pradesh, the 185th-largest of 424 villages in Bindki tehsil. Literacy is 74%, 13 points above the tehsil average of 61% and the sex ratio is 908 women per 1,000 men. The pincode is 212665, served by Mauhar post office; the LGD village code is 156153. The sarpanch is PUSHPA DEVI, and the village votes in Sawayazpur assembly constituency, represented by MLA Madhavendra Pratap Singh. The population is estimated at 1,595 in 2026, up 18% since the 2011 Census.
